THE WOMEN LEADING THE WAY AT MIDLANDS PARK HOTEL
Midlands Park Hotel
International Women’s Day is a moment to recognise the women whose dedication and leadership shape the places we work and the communities we serve. At Midlands Park Hotel, women play a vital role across every department, creating memorable guest experiences and fostering a culture of respect, collaboration and care.
This year, we’re shining a light on some of the incredible women within our team, each bringing their own story, strengths and inspiration. Together, they reflect the resilience and spirit that make Midlands Park Hotel such a special place to work.

Here are their voices.
Emma Ainsworth
Director of Sales
I lead our sales strategy, develop long-lasting client relationships and work with our teams to create exceptional guest experiences.
What I enjoy most is the energy of the role, as every day brings new opportunities and partnerships. The culture here is special, collaborative, supportive and built on people who genuinely care.
A woman who inspires me is my friend Caitriona, who faced breast cancer during pregnancy with extraordinary courage. She welcomed her baby girl while navigating treatment and later endured the loss of her brother. Through everything, she continues to show strength, gratitude and positivity that lifts everyone around her.
